I Had an Eating Disorder. So Did My Daughter. Here's How We Found Healing.

Dela

Cognitive neuroscientist Dr. Caroline Leaf and her daughter Dominique Leaf sit down to talk about something neither has discussed this openly before: their own eating disorders, and how one was handed to the other.Caroline counted calories at university, down to 500 a day, until her sister picked up an apple and asked whether she was working out the number in her head. Dominique was diagnosed with anorexia at 13, spent over a year in therapy, and says plainly that she blamed her mother and grandmother for years. What follows is how that pattern moves through a family, what broke it in both cases, and the two exercises Dominique's therapist gave her that still work when the old thinking comes back.They also get into whether we should ever comment on another person's body, what GLP-1s have done to the culture around thinness, and why "she was trying to protect me" changed how Dominique understood her grandmother.Content Note: This episode discusses eating disorders and related topics.
